Job ResponsibilitiesThis position is based at TTC's Thornley Campus, but the candidate must be willing to provide online services as needed.
Candidate must be able to function in an environment characterized by continual changes in information technology.
Responsibilities include teaching courses, designing and developing courses, and assessing student performance.
Minimum and Additional RequirementsThis position requires a bachelor’s degree in Engineering or a strongly related field and related industry/engineering/surveying experience.
Preferred QualificationsPost-secondary teaching experience is a plus.
Excellent customer service and interpersonal skills, and the ability to function in an environment characterized by continual changes in information technology is essential.
